In everyday academic life, many difficulties do not stem from a lack of ability but from automatic ideas that filter what students believe is possible. These ideas, which sometimes go unnoticed, influence motivation, the way of studying and, above all, how error is interpreted. Understanding how they work and what to do with them makes the difference between slow progress and sustained progress. Below is a practical, applied guide to identify them in time and replace them effectively.

What they are and how they operate in learning

They are ingrained judgments that the student assumes as truths about themselves, others or tasks. Typical examples: "I'm not a science person", "if I ask a question I'll look ridiculous", "if it doesn't work for me the first time, I'm no good at this". They operate like lenses: they select information that confirms the prejudice and discard the contrary. Thus, a good grade is attributed to luck and a stumble is interpreted as confirmation of a personal limit.

In behavioral terms, they generate avoidance, procrastination, paralyzing perfectionism or over-demanding standards. In emotional terms, they trigger anxiety, frustration and shame. The key to intervening is to deautomatize this circuit: detect the thought, question its validity and replace it with one that is more useful and proven by experience.

Early signs that reveal their presence

They are not always expressed aloud; many times they are inferred by patterns. These signs tend to appear together and with increasing frequency around subjects perceived as difficult.

  • Absolute language: "always", "never", "everyone can except me".
  • Internal, stable and global explanations for failure: "I'm stupid", "I'm no good at studying".
  • Avoiding participation or choosing tasks that are too easy to avoid exposure.
  • Chronic procrastination right before key subjects.
  • Perfectionism that leads to starting over at the slightest mistake.
  • Disproportionate emotional distress in response to small setbacks.

Common types in the school environment

Although each person is unique, there are patterns that repeatedly appear at different educational levels.

  • Fixed ability label: "I was born bad at numbers/languages".
  • Fear of social evaluation: "if I fail, they'll judge me".
  • Confusion between outcome and personal worth: "if I get a bad grade, I'm worth less".
  • All-or-nothing: "if I don't understand everything, I understood nothing".
  • External control: "I only pass if the teacher is easy".
  • Mind reading and catastrophizing: "they'll surely think I'm a failure".

Why they form and persist

They arise from early experiences, messages from the environment, social comparisons and assessments focused only on the outcome. They are consolidated through cognitive biases: we pay attention to what confirms the belief and avoid situations that could refute it. Vague feedback ("you're a genius", "this isn't your thing") also fixes labels instead of guiding the process.

To weaken them, it is advisable to introduce small but repeated corrective experiences, and language that recognizes effective effort, the strategies used and progression, not just the final grade.

Practical methods to detect them

Thought diary in context

Ask the student to, when faced with a challenging task, record the situation, emotion, automatic thought and behavior. In a few days repeating patterns emerge.

  • Situation: "physics exam on Friday".
  • Emotion: "anxiety 8/10".
  • Thought: "I'll draw a blank".
  • Behavior: "I postponed reviewing".

Socratic guiding questions

  • What objective evidence supports this idea? What evidence contradicts it?
  • If a friend thought this about themselves, what would you tell them?
  • Is there an alternative explanation that is equally or more plausible?
  • On a scale of 0 to 10, how sure are you? What would move you one point?

Observation of behavior patterns

  • Subjects systematically avoided.
  • Choosing low-difficulty tasks to "secure" success.
  • Intense reaction to corrective feedback.

Steps to deactivate them effectively

  • Name it precisely: move from "I'm no good" to "I have difficulty solving quadratic equations on exams". The concrete is trainable.
  • Question the label: list 3 recent counterexamples (micro-successes, partial improvements, understanding of a subtopic).
  • Reframe in process terms: "I don't master X yet; with strategy Y and practice Z, I'll improve".
  • Design a behavioral experiment: a small, measurable test that can refute the belief (e.g., 3 sessions of 20 minutes with self-explanation and then a mini-quiz).
  • Measure and compare: record results before and after to see the real change, not just the impression.
  • Inoculate against error: anticipate failures and plan responses ("if I blank out, I breathe, jot down what I do know and move to the next").
  • Consolidate with spaced practice and specific feedback about strategy, not about personal labels.

Strategies for the classroom and home

Language and feedback

  • Describe processes: "I noticed you broke the problem into parts and that helped you".
  • Value strategic decisions, not fixed traits.
  • Normalize error as information: "what failed was strategy A; let's try B".

Task design

  • Progress path: staggered exercises with increasing difficulty.
  • Visible scaffolding: worked examples, step lists and clear rubrics.
  • Opportunities to retry with written reflection on what changed.

Habits and environment

  • Brief, frequent study blocks with a micro-goal and a review close.
  • Record of micro-victories to show progress.
  • Modeling self-talk: adults think aloud about how they face difficulty.

Two practical cases and their transformation

Case 1: "I have no memory for history"

Situation: after forgetting dates on an exam, the student concludes that their memory is bad. Intervention: define the real problem ("I have trouble linking facts to timelines"), introduce visual mapping and active retrieval technique with flashcards. Experiment: 15 minutes daily for 7 days, self-assessment without looking at notes every 48 hours.

Result: a 30% improvement in recall of dates and, above all, more confidence when explaining causal connections. Reformulated belief: "when I organize information visually and practice retrieval, I remember better".

Case 2: "If I ask, they'll think I'm stupid"

Situation: avoids raising their hand; low participation and incomplete understanding. Intervention: agree on one question per class and use a bridging phrase ("to make sure I understood, may I check...?"). Ask the teacher for private feedback on the quality of the question.

Result: increased participation, confirmation that questions help others and do not generate negative judgment. Reformulated belief: "asking questions improves my understanding and is well received".

Quick checklist and common mistakes

  • Did I identify the exact thought and the situation where it appears?
  • Did I gather evidence for and against it in writing?
  • Did I design a small, measurable experiment to test it?
  • Did I record results and compare them, not just "feel" the improvement?
  • Did I adjust the strategy, not my worth as a person?
  • Common mistake: trying to change everything at once; better to focus on a specific target.
  • Common mistake: using empty affirmations without evidence; better to use reformulations anchored in actions.
  • Common mistake: confusing discomfort with ineffectiveness; deep learning is often uncomfortable.

21-day plan to consolidate change

  • Days 1–3: thought recording and selection of a target belief.
  • Days 4–7: formulate an alternative hypothesis and design an experiment (short daily task + mini-quiz).
  • Days 8–14: spaced practice with strategy adjustment according to results; ask for specific feedback.
  • Days 15–18: increase difficulty by 10–20% while maintaining the support structure.
  • Days 19–21: synthesis of learnings, list evidence of progress and define the next micro-area to work on.

Transforming beliefs requires consistency, real-world testing and an environment that reinforces the process. When the student learns to observe their internal dialogue, to experiment with strategies and to measure their own progress, they stop living difficulty as a verdict and turn it into a practice ground. That, more than any label, is what opens up possibilities for sustained learning.
